Goresbrook 135 for 3 beat Wanstead 30 all out by 105 runs

Goresbrook’s captain for the day Ben Irving won the toss, the first toss 'Brook had won in seven games and decided to bat first in this 20 over friendly.' Brook changed round their order to try and give some more players a chance to impress and get into form and they did not disappoint. Jack Stead fell early for 2 but skipper Ben Irving joined Stuart Greaves and the pair started to score freely. Greaves was run out for 9, however Aaron Scott hit a quick-fire 15, his best score for the colts so far. Ben Irving retired on a fine 33, his knock included five fine boundaries. Ausman Ginai then came in and was in superb nick, he struck a quite majestic 30 before he had to retire also, hitting the boundary rope on five occasions. Bobby Gaymer hit 16 not out at the end of the innings allowing 'Brook to post a decent 135 for 3 in their allotted over’s.

In reply, Irving decided to open up with a full spin attack, and it was a great decision. Shane Barwick took 2 for 5 from his 4 overs and Callum Shepherd taking a superb 4 for 11 from his four overs. The game was over after the first 8 overs, but 'Brook's other bowlers continued the good work with Greaves taking 1 for 6 and Jack Stead taking 2 for 6, along with a good run out from a Shepherd throw. There were some superb catches taken also with Barwick taking two, one being an absolute cracker. Gaymer took a superb catch on the mid-wicket boundary and there were catches for Irving and Read as 'Brook crushed Wanstead bowling them out for 30, giving a resounding 105 run victory to the away side.
